EU wants early US talks to avert Trump tariffs
- The European Union is seeking early discussions with the US regarding planned tariffs by President Donald Trump, as stated by trade chief Maros Sefcovic.
- Ursula von der Leyen emphasized that the EU will protect its interests while negotiating with the US on trade matters.
- Sefcovic noted that the EU and US trade relationship supports four million jobs and has a deficit of around 50 billion euros.
- Luxembourg Foreign Minister Xavier Bettel insisted that the EU must remain united and strong, avoiding early concessions in negotiations.
